A member asked:

Gp said it's from stress and anxiety, i have stiff neck, bad headaches that doesn't really go, and pressure on front of head and sides when moving. ?

2 doctors weighed in across 2 answers

Tension migraine: Tension migraine is a type of headache caused by contraction of the muscles that attach to the skull. The headaches often worsen as the day progresses. Treatment includes massage, physical therapy, biofeedback and meditation to reduce stress and anxiety. Botox injections in the scalp muscles and a variety of medications may reduce the headaches. See a neurologist who specializes in headaches.

Muscle spasms in: your neck is probably cause of your stiff neck and also headaches. Muscle relaxants which are prescription medications with over the counter pain medications for headache take care of your problems. If it does not help then see a neurologist.
